The motherboard or mainboard is the component that connects all the different parts of your computer. Often it has some integrated components like a sound card, enabling your computer to play sound, or a network card, to connect your computer to the network. The standard form factor (size) for motherboards is ATX, you need at least a midi-tower to fit one of those in. Micro-ATX motherboards are often more complete and have more onboard devices, like a video board and fit in smaller cases, but are generally less expandable.

DISCLAIMER: these specs are for revision 1.0.

Intel® Thunderbolt™ 3 Certified Motherboard
Supports 6th Generation Intel® Core™ Processor
Dual Channel DDR4, 4 DIMMs
Intel® USB 3.1 with USB Type-C™ - The World's Next Universal Connector
3-Way Graphics Support with Exclusive Ultra Durable Metal Shielding over the PCIe Slots
Dual PCIe Gen3 x4 M.2 Connectors with up to 32Gb/s Data Transfer (PCIe NVMe & SATA SSD support)
3 SATA Express Connectors for up to 16Gb/s Data Transfer
Integrated HDMI 2.0 support
Creative SoundCore™ 3D Gaming Audio
Killer™ E2400 and Intel® Gaming Networks
LED Trace Path with Multi-Color Choice
APP Center Including EasyTune™ and Cloud Station™ Utilities
GIGABYTE UEFI DualBIOS™ Technology
